Today, we are still looking at Genesis 30. After Rachel gave birth to Joseph, Jacob decides to peacefully leave his father-in-law's house (Genesis 30:25). He tells Laban, "Give me my wives and my children for whom I have served you, and let me go; for you know my service which I have done for you." (Genesis 30:26).

Laban was reluctant to let Jacob depart because he realized that God increased and blessed him because of Jacob's presence.

Jacob was a blessed man so wherever he went, the covenant of God's blessings followed him and it also flowed to those around him through the works of his hands.

When Laban asked Jacob whether he desired to be paid, Jacob requested for the speckled and spotted sheep and all the brown ones among the lambs, including the spotted and speckled among the goats as his wages (Genesis 30:32). Laban agreed with Jacob. After this conversation, Laban deceitfully removed all the speckled and spotted lambs and goats including the brown ones among the lambs and gave them to his sons (Genesis 30:35) instead of Jacob.


Despite Laban cheating Jacob of his wages, the LORD God continued to guide and surround Jacob with His presence. Jacob continued his work of taking care of Laban's flock and with God's wisdom, he 'developed a technology' where he supernaturally induced the flocks to conceive speckled and spotted young ones.

That is, "Now Jacob took for himself rods of green poplar and of the almond and chestnut trees, peeled white strips in them, and exposed the white which was in the rods. And the rods which he had peeled, he set before the flocks in the gutters, in the watering troughs where the flocks came to drink, so that they should conceive when they came to drink. So the flocks conceived before the rods, and the flocks brought forth streaked, speckled and spotted." (Genesis 30:36-39 NKJV).

This enabled Jacob to separate the brown lambs, the streaked, speckled and spotted goats and sheep as agreed with Laban. During this entire time, the LORD made sure to continually bless Jacob regardless of his circumstances and he became exceedingly prosperous with numerous herds of flocks, camels, donkeys, female and male servants (Genesis 30:43), just like his grandfather Abraham.
